Signalr android webview download

Sep 26, 2011 hey, im trying to get signalr working from a native android app, using the phonegap framework. The problem is that the websocket cannot connecting. I am completely new to mobile development and i dont know where to start. Build cross platform video chat with xamarin and vidyo. I connected chrome to do remote debug to the apps webview and i can see the network tab. Net implementationsnet standard allows the same code and libraries to be used on the server, in the browser, or anywhere you write. Network configuration manager ncm is designed to deliver powerful network configuration and compliance management. Once the clientside of signalr is running in webview we send all the request through webview to the server and whatever returns we save it in file and then read the file to process it using corona api. As youve already pointed out, push notifications are typically used for app messages. Lastest update of adroid webview is causing errors in our app with signalr connection. Signalr can be used to add any sort of realtime web functionality to your asp.

Basically, phonegap renders html5jscss into a webview android or uiwebview ios, so i tought i would have this running pretty quickly. Realtime android and ios apps using signalr core asp. Real time communication with signalr android client 1. It can also provide the basic realtime communications for a connected windows universal application or even ios and android.

Ive been looking at various links but none of them provide proper information about implementation. This feature comes preinstalled on almost all devices and should only be updated or installed if youre sure its necessary. Net signalr not working on xamarin webview, could please let me know what i am missing. Sep 20, 2018 contribute to signalrjava client development by creating an account on github. Android system webview for pc windows 7, 8, 10 mac. Android question webview does not load page b4x community.

Maka dengan webview kita bisa membuat aplikasi androidnya berbentuk apk tentunya dapat diinstall pada smartphone android sehingga ketika kita ingin mengakses hanya perlu menyentuh icon badoystudio yang sudah terinstall dismartphone android. Webview android full support yes, chrome android full support yes, firefox android. If i open through the browser, then everything works without problems. If you have the xamarin pcl extensions installed then it should be possible to install signalr client into your monoandroid project. How to implement push notification to android from signalr. We will still deal with the old webview for a couple of years. Net features like dependency injection, authentication, authorization, and scalability.

Pagea and pageb both create separate connections in order to receive updates from the server. Oct 09, 2017 signalr do not start on android 7, 6 and 5 with latest android webviewchrome version. Also, in this repository you can find app example written in kotlin language. Net signalr javascript library, which is working fine from desktop. I tried using the non web client code in my web api so when the android app makes an connection web api would call signalr module to inform signalr but it is not working well. When user goes to webview and click a link to download a file nothing happens. Christos matskas demonstrates how to get started with creating applications across a range of platforms that require realtime communication using signalr. Find out what it can do in your ios and android apps, too. If we want to receive response via same calling method then how to get. Lastest update of adroid webview is causing errors in our.

I have an app which uses signalr when i try it in the browser it works properly. I want to implement an android application that will accept push notification from server. The xamarin development platform makes it possible to build cross platform applications with a common code base. Now, signalr has been made available to android and java developers via an sdk from microsoft open technologies. For html code that is limited in terms of scope, we can implement the static method fromhtml that belongs to the html utility class for parsing htmlformatted string and displaying it in a textview textview can render simple formatting like styles bold, italic, etc. As far as standards go, signalr uses standard websockets, and falls back to older technologies for web browsers that dont support websockets. I recently started experimenting with signalr for real time updates from a server in xamarin. The simple programming model integrates seamlessly with other asp. Is there a bug with android system webview in android10. The signalr javascript client library is delivered as an npm package. Everybody at android and chrome team is talking about the new webview but nobody is even mentioning what will happen to the browser.

Android webview is a system component powered by chrome that allows android apps to display web content. This component is preinstalled on your device and should be kept up to date to ensure you have the latest security updates and other bug fixes. I have used xamaring android with signalr client 2. I went through lot of difficulties since there is a very few online resources available for reference to implement signal r in android, but somehow i figured it out by putting lot of time and effort on it. So, right now, we are using hidden webview which downloads the signalr js generated by and store it on local folder. How to use signalr in android signalr in android real time chat in android send chat message using signalr in android received chat message in android read status in. Follow the help article about the play store wont open, load, or download apps. Jul 25, 20 i am trying to create a scenario were if an android app makes a connection to my web api. Any time a user refreshes a web page to see new data, or the page implements long polling to retrieve new data, it is a candidate for using signalr. Xamarin android with signalr client xamarin forums. Nov 16, 2015 signalr isnt just for web applications.

Websockets signalr by frank arkhurst odoom frankodoom signalr. Net signalr 3 building a realtime 4 implementing signalr on android. Im trying to bring signalr into my android studio project i successfully followed the tutorial on getting started with signalr, so now i have a working hub. Lastest update of adroid webview is causing errors in our app. How to use signalr library in android at client side.

Net crossplatform ui toolkit that targets the mobile, tablet, and desktop form factors on android, ios, and more. Now we are planning to wrap this web application as an android application. Signalr in android studio unable to implement p2p chat using signalr in android. It can also provide the basic realtime communications for a connected windows universal application or even ios and android applications. While chat is often used as an example, you can do a whole lot more. I am trying to integrate signalr in android app but no luck. Get up and running with signalr java sdk for android. There are many good android emulators in market, the best one is andy, bluestacks, nox app player and mynamo. Client has a portable library that looks like it is targeting profile 158.

Hey, im trying to get signalr working from a native android app, using the phonegap framework. Some of the questions asked but not much information. But not working while i am loading text messaging url on xamarin webview. May 30, 2016 create a push notification system with signalr. For example, only add the minified javascript file to the. With this last part is where android webview latest update is causing us troubles, because we are using signalr client services technology and signalr server technology to do the track of the units that wants to be tracked, in order to read from the server where is exactly the position of the unit, how ever in the last update of the android. The following sections outline different ways to install the client library. Install signalr in xamarin xamarin community forums. Nov 21, 2016 real time communication with signalr android client 1. Net web application which uses signalr to push data to the active clients. Realtime communications with signalr deepak gupta 2.

In this description we use connection to simple server with bearer authorization. Microsoft internet explorer versions 8, 9, 10, and 11. Websocket in webview xamarin forms not working angular. Download android system webview for pc with bluestacks. Steps to get signalr working in android studio stack. Applications that use signalr in browsers must use jquery version 1. A user can navigate from pagea to pageb and currently, both connections remain alive. If you really know github, 40 issues and 10 prs are really small numbers.

Lastest update of adroid webview is causing errors in our app with. Connecting through the azure signalr service will require android api level 20 and later because the azure signalr service requires tls 1. Signalr integration has to be done inside serviceintent service. Net core, egyptian developer mohammed hamdy ghanem told visual studio magazine about. I read somewhere that you need to allow android to use the locale storage. Net developers use it often for apps that need frequent server updates. Webview from android is a fundamental part of chromes technology that allows other android apps to show web content.

Using signalr to create mobile applications simple talk. The signalr java client will run on android api level 16 and later. Nov 12, 2019 the signalr java client will run on android api level 16 and later. With this last part is where android webview latest update is causing us troubles, because we are using signalr client services technology and. For more information about xamarin support for android oreo, see the xamarin.

Real time communication with signalr android client. Create a push notification system with signalr youtube. Contribute to ngocchungsimplesignalrclient development by creating an account on github. Android added support for sha256 and above cipher suites in api level 20. Recently i developed a android chatting application for the company called zupportdesk. Signalr is used for general realtime communication. Android webview tutorial with an example project download. Is it possible to send push notification to android and ios. How do i allow users to upload and download files to my website from my app. Cara membuat webview dengan progress bar android studio. Building a chat application with signalr sitepoint. Libman can be used to install specific client library files from the cdnhosted client library. Signalr can be used in a variety of web browsers, but typically, only the latest two versions are supported.

There are 2 ways to download the file from within android webview. Microsoft releases signalr sdk for android, java visual. If i simply load the application in android webview will still my signalr pushes continue to work. The client in that tutorial is javascript, and i got it working ok in a web page in chrome on pc and on my android phone over wifi on my home lan. Jul 16, 2015 building a chat application with signalr.

790 1389 906 810 1614 467 792 1389 1550 909 1650 1456 758 1098 234 1014 30 940 116 1185 17 102 654 1406 160 557 995 676